American Airlines Cancels Flights: Hundreds of August 2025 Trips Affected Nationwide

American Airlines cancels flights for August 2025, disrupting the travel plans of thousands of passengers just weeks before peak vacation season. The airline has quietly removed hundreds of flights from its schedule, triggering concern across the U.S. as travelers scramble to confirm their itineraries.

Reports from passengers and aviation insiders reveal that many domestic and international routes have either been canceled outright or reduced in frequency. The changes are already visible in American’s booking system, affecting flights throughout the first two weeks of August.


Why American Airlines Cancels Flights in August 2025

The decision to cancel flights is reportedly linked to operational restructuring, pilot staffing issues, and internal scheduling revisions. The airline is also believed to be optimizing its fleet usage by removing lower-demand or overlapping routes to reduce delays and congestion.

Key highlights include:

  • Over 850 flights removed from early-August schedules.
  • Major hubs impacted: Dallas-Fort Worth (DFW), Charlotte (CLT), Chicago O’Hare (ORD).
  • Popular destinations cut or reduced, especially in the Caribbean and Europe.
OriginDestinationStatus
DFWCancunReduced
ORDBostonCanceled
CLTMiamiReduced
LAXLondonCanceled for August

This move comes as a surprise, especially during a season when air travel demand is expected to reach record highs.


“American Airlines Cancels Flights” – What You Must Know

If you’re one of the many who booked flights with American Airlines for August, you should take immediate steps to confirm your travel details.

Here’s what to do now:

  • Check your booking status using the American Airlines app or website.
  • Look for cancellation emails or app alerts, as some travelers have reported receiving little to no warning.
  • Contact customer support to request a rebooking, refund, or alternative route if your flight is affected.
  • Explore other carriers early to avoid last-minute fare hikes.

Many travelers are already rebooking flights through alternative airports or shifting their travel dates to avoid further disruption.
